2. Where Can You Find the Best Beach in Bali?

One of the most frequently asked questions by travelers visiting the island is, “Where is the best beach in Bali?” Bali is a big island with plenty of coastline, and the answer depends on what kind of beach experience you’re after. If you’re looking for something more touristy and lively, beaches around Seminyak, Kuta, and Jimbaran are the go-to spots. For a more serene and less crowded vibe, beaches in the south like Pandawa Beach or Melasti Beach are ideal for relaxing and enjoying the quieter side of Bali.

The location of the best beach in Bali really depends on your mood. If you want to explore beyond the typical tourist hotspots, Bali’s east and north coasts offer pristine, untouched beaches that feel like hidden gems.

4. What Activities Can You Do at the Best Beach in Bali?

One of the reasons Bali is famous is because of the wide variety of activities available at its beaches. Whether you’re an adrenaline junkie or someone looking for a more relaxed experience, you’ll find plenty to do at the best beach in Bali.

Surfing

For surfers, Bali is a paradise. Beaches like Uluwatu, Padang Padang, and Canggu are world-renowned surf spots that offer everything from beginner-friendly waves to challenging breaks for experienced surfers. Many of the best beaches in Bali have surf schools, so even if you’re new to the sport, you can take a lesson and ride your first wave.

Snorkeling and Diving

If you’re into exploring underwater, you’ll find some of the best snorkeling and diving spots along Bali’s beaches. The coral reefs are teeming with marine life, including colorful fish, turtles, and even manta rays at spots like Nusa Penida and Menjangan Island. For beginners, snorkeling at beaches like Amed or Blue Lagoon offers a glimpse into Bali’s rich underwater ecosystem without the need for advanced diving skills.

Beach Clubs and Sunset Watching

For a more laid-back vibe, some of the best beaches in Bali are home to trendy beach clubs where you can sip cocktails while watching the sunset. Spots like Finns Beach Club in Canggu or Potato Head in Seminyak have become iconic locations for relaxing in style. Nothing beats watching the sky turn shades of pink and orange as the sun dips below the horizon.

Relaxation and Wellness

For those looking to unwind, Bali’s beaches are also home to some of the best wellness experiences in the world. You can find yoga retreats, beachfront massages, and meditation sessions along the quieter shores like Sanur or Bingin Beach. These are the perfect places to recharge your body and mind while soaking in the beauty of nature.

7. When is the Best Time to Visit the Best Beach in Bali?

Timing is everything when it comes to enjoying the best of Bali’s beaches. The best time to visit the best beach in Bali is during the dry season, which runs from April to October. During these months, the weather is typically sunny, and the seas are calmer, making it ideal for swimming, surfing, and other beach activities.

However, Bali’s tropical climate means you can enjoy its beaches year-round, but the wet season (November to March) can bring heavier rains, which may limit some outdoor activities. If you’re visiting during the rainy season, it’s still possible to enjoy beach life, but be prepared for occasional downpours.
